Subject: [PATCH] ASoC: audio-graph-card: enable mclk-fs on codec node

Current audio-graph-card is supporting mclk-fs on CPU node
side only. But having Codec node also is good idea.
It will be just ignored if not defined.

"rcpu_ep" is same as "cpu_ep", This patch tidyup it, too.
